How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 83204?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 83204 Studio Apartments | $692 | $625 | $850 |
| 83204 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,047 | $650 | $1,333 |
| 83204 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,142 | $780 | $1,579 |
| 83204 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,400 | $850 | $2,000 |

Frequently Asked Questions about the 83204 ZIP Code
How much are Studio apartments in 83204?
There are currently 20 Studio Apartments in 83204 with rent ranges from $625 to $850 with an average price of $692.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om 83204 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 83204 ranges from $650 to $1,333 with an average monthly rent of $1,047.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 83204 c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 83204 range from $780 to $1,579.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,142.
How expensive are 83204 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 34 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 83204 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$850 to $2,000 - averaging $1,400 for the location.
